Europarl approves 1.8-bln-euro support package for Moldova, 1st tranche amounting to 20%

CHISINAU. Jan 30 (Interfax) - The European Parliament on January 30 approved a report on a new 1.8-billion-euro support facility for Moldova, European parliamentarian Siegfried Muresan, who presented the report, said on his social account.

"The European Parliament has just adopted my report on a financial support facility for Moldova worth 1.8 billion euros," Muresan said.

"I convinced my colleagues to propose increasing pre-financing from 7% to 20% of the total amount. These are funds that will reach Moldova right away after the facility enters into force," he said.

The Council of the EU is expected to finalize its clearance for disbursing 1.8 billion euros for Moldova in March, he said.

As reported, European Commission President Ursula von der Leyen announced in Chisinau on October 10, 2024 that the EU would provide Moldova with a 1.8-billion-euro support package called Reform and Growth Facility to underpin its economic development.
